Output 7e5cc59c11fc032449862bb84066abd49a3bf109cee0b592b289a497c0cb476e:0

value
21371518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d737d709d2573fff0a57273e501de91c9fcb271d OP_EQUAL
address
MTX8QWDQBvcRprsABP6hheEbbBQLhSdpf5
transaction
7e5cc59c11fc032449862bb84066abd49a3bf109cee0b592b289a497c0cb476e
spent
true